How to install the PlatformIO tools are described in their documentation here, but for a Mac Homebrew user it might be easiest with:
brew install platformio
To ensure everything is working you should try to compile the source code with
make
If this is the first time running platformio it will also download required tools and libraries defined in the platform.ini file.
